首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

Python SQLite3在Github操作上失败,但在本地不会失败

Python SQLite3是一个轻量级的关系型数据库,它提供了一个简单的方式来操作SQLite数据库。在Github操作上失败,但在本地不会失败的问题可能是由于以下几个原因导致的:

  1. 网络连接问题:在Github上操作时,可能存在网络连接不稳定或者网络延迟较高的情况,导致操作失败。可以尝试检查网络连接是否正常,或者尝试使用其他网络环境进行操作。
  2. 权限问题:Github上的操作可能需要特定的权限才能执行,例如对仓库的写入权限。请确保你具有足够的权限来执行所需的操作。
  3. 数据库文件路径问题:在本地操作SQLite数据库时,通常会指定一个本地路径来访问数据库文件。但在Github上操作时,可能需要使用不同的路径或者相对路径来访问数据库文件。请确保你在Github上操作时使用了正确的路径。
  4. 代码逻辑问题:在Github上操作失败的原因也可能是由于代码逻辑错误导致的。请仔细检查你的代码,确保没有语法错误或者逻辑错误。

针对以上可能的原因,可以尝试以下解决方案:

  1. 检查网络连接:确保你的网络连接正常,并且没有任何阻塞或者限制。
  2. 检查权限:确认你具有执行所需操作的权限。如果没有权限,请联系仓库的管理员或者相关人员获取权限。
  3. 检查路径:在Github上操作SQLite数据库时,确保使用了正确的路径来访问数据库文件。可以尝试使用相对路径或者绝对路径来访问数据库文件。
  4. 调试代码:仔细检查你的代码,确保没有语法错误或者逻辑错误。可以使用调试工具来逐步执行代码并查看错误信息。

腾讯云提供了一系列与云计算相关的产品,包括数据库、服务器、云原生等。对于SQLite数据库的替代方案,腾讯云提供了云数据库 TencentDB,它是一种高性能、可扩展的关系型数据库服务。你可以使用TencentDB来存储和管理数据,并且可以通过腾讯云的控制台或者API进行操作。更多关于腾讯云数据库的信息可以参考腾讯云官方文档:TencentDB产品介绍

请注意,以上答案仅供参考,具体解决方法可能需要根据实际情况进行调试和调整。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

Electron那些事10:本地数据库sqlite

【前言】 一节讲了本地日志,本地数据(文件)的部分, 详见:Electron那些事09:本地数据_uikoo9的博客-CSDN博客 虽然本地日志可以记录日志信息, 本地数据可以记录简单的配置文件,...但是像一些复杂的业务,需要维护一个本地数据库进行查询,本节讲一下本地数据库sqlite 【sqlite】 sqlite是有名的本地数据库,很多系统中都有应用,SQLite Home Page 当然也有...类环境使用,例如nw框架使用 另外还有sqlcipher版本,就是加密的本地数据库版本 【安装和使用】 安装比较简单 npm i sqlite3 先看官网一个例子 var sqlite3 = require...这个npm包,单独使用没有问题, 但是mac m1+electron环境下使用会报错,如下 报错提示找不到arm64下的文件,但是sqlite3下有x64版本的, 修复的版本,npm i的时候添加指定系统...npm install --target_arch=arm64 这样即可安装arm64版本的sqlite3 【qiao-sqlite】 将常见的sqlite操作封装了一个npm,qiao-sqlite

1.9K20

聊聊NPM镜像那些险象环生的坑

nrm操作 遇坑填坑 有了nrm切换到淘宝镜像,安装速度会明显加快,但是遇上安装的模块依赖了C++模块那就坑爹了。...安装node-sass时,install阶段会从Github上下载一个叫binding.node的文件,而「GitHub Releases」里的文件都托管s3.amazonaws.com,这个网址被.../ npm config set python_mirror https://npm.taobao.org/mirrors/python/ 有了这波操作,再执行npm i安装以上模块时就能享受国内的速度了...Mac系统和Linux系统删除node_modules比较快,但是Windows系统删除node_modules就比较慢了,推荐大家使用rimraf删除node_modules,一个Node版的...执行npm i前设置淘宝镜像,保证安装项目依赖时都走国内网络 安装不成功时,肯定是安装过程中该模块内部又去下载了其他国外服务器的文件 Github克隆一份该模块的源码进行分析,搜索包含base、binary

5.1K51

iOS开发之SQLite--C语言接口规范(五)——iOS开发使用SQLite实例

因为本实例要对数据库的数据进行modify(修改)操作iOS系统呢,为了安全起见,Bundle中的数据库资源是不允许进行数据的插入修改和删除操作的。...之前的博客中我们只进行了查询操作,所以从Bundle加载数据库资源文件是可行的。   ...如果对数据库进程insert, update, delete等操作,那么需要在打开数据库之前把Bundle中的数据库拷贝到沙盒中(每个App都有自己的沙盒,没有越狱的机器,App只可以访问自己的沙盒...代码好多,博客篇幅有限,就不一一的去往上粘贴代码了,具体代码实现回GitHub上进行分享,gitHub连接请看本博客的末尾处,代码中也是关键部分添加了相应的注释。   ...先读取数据库中的数据,TableView上进行加载,然后可以对数据进行添加和删除操作,更新操作就不做演示了。插入操作中有如果有这条数据就进行Replace,这变相是一个update操作

1.8K60

安全之配置不当信息泄露

注意:本文分享给安全从业人员、网站开发人员以及运维人员日常工作防范恶意攻击,请勿恶意使用下面介绍技术进行非法攻击操作。。...(3)对攻击行为进行监控,一般这样做之后会杜绝大部分的配置不当问题, 其他信息泄露问题主要是采用自检或者src白帽子提交的漏洞来发现,发现之后走修复流程不会分层做。...//wvvdey-8080-ooqzry.dev.ide.live/.git #ubuntu@WeiyiGeek:~/10.10.17.222/test/.git$ index.html #克隆镜像到本地...查看数据库 sqlite3.exe .svn/wc.db "select * from work _queue" python gitsvnScan.py http://ricewater.cn/ python...(3).如果是公司的核心技术代码,可能会被商业竞争对手盗去,对公司造成经济的损失。

51510

安全之配置不当信息泄露

注意:本文分享给安全从业人员,网站开发人员和运维人员日常工作中使用和防范恶意攻击,请勿恶意使用下面描述技术进行非法操作。...(3)对攻击行为进行监控,一般这样做之后会杜绝大部分的配置不当问题, 其他信息泄露问题主要是采用自检或者src白帽子提交的漏洞来发现,发现之后走修复流程不会分层做。.../wvvdey-8080-ooqzry.dev.ide.live/.git #[email protected]:~/10.10.17.222/test/.git$ index.html #克隆镜像到本地...查看数据库 sqlite3.exe .svn/wc.db "select * from work _queue" python gitsvnScan.py http://ricewater.cn/ python...(3).如果是公司的核心技术代码,可能会被商业竞争对手盗去,对公司造成经济的损失。

1.4K70

一点多发FTP客户端设计

最近遇到一个问题就是:服务器上部署到很多个FTP客户端定时程序,每个FTP客户端exe可执行程序功能都是类似的,都是将本地服务器中的某个文件夹下的符合文件规则(如*.json,*.xml)文件通过FTP...FTP File Upload Version2.0版 第一个版本的基础做了另外一个版本,增加了Windows服务程序 ?...,以便多次重复传输(这里要注意剔除哪些本地目录已经不存在但是在数据库中还有上传记录的文件上传记录信息) 程序执行流程图 程序流程图如下图所示: ?...,基于此类简单封装了一下基于Sqlite3操作。...,以便多次重复传输(这里要注意剔除哪些本地目录已经不存在但是在数据库中还有上传记录的文件上传记录信息) */ int main() { // 创建数据库类对象 signal_log lg; TaskDB

78020

python的pandas打开csv文件_如何使用Pandas DataFrame打开CSV文件 – python

然后照常读取文件: import pandas csvfile = pandas.read_csv(‘file.csv’, encoding=’utf-8′) 如何使用Pandas groupby添加顺序计数器列...这个程序包有python端口吗?如果不存在,是否可以通过python使用该包? python参考方案 最近,我遇到了pingouin库。如何用’-‘解析字符串到节点js本地脚本?...– python 我正在使用本地节点js脚本来处理字符串。我陷入了将’-‘字符串解析为本地节点js脚本的问题。render.js:#!...– python 我的Web服务器的API日志如下:started started succeeded failed 那是同时收到的两个请求。很难说哪一个成功或失败。...sqlite3数据库已锁定 – pythonWindows使用Python 3和sqlite3

11.6K30

Python扩展库安装与常见问题解决完整指南

Python自带的pip工具是管理扩展库的主要方式,支持Python扩展库的安装、升级和卸载等操作。...在线安装失败最大的可能有三个:1)网络不好导致下载失败,2)需要本地安装有正确版本的VC++编译环境,3)扩展库暂时还不支持自己使用的Python版本。...如果出现第二种错误,可以本地安装合适版本的VC++编译器或者下载whl文件离线安装。对于第三种错误,可以尝试找一下有没有第三方编译好的whl文件可以下载然后离线安装。...这样的问题基本可以肯定是安装路径和使用路径不一致造成的。 注意,如果计算机上安装了多个版本的Python开发环境,一个版本下安装的扩展库无法另一个版本中使用。...不管是多牛的程序员,写出来的代码都有可能会存在bug,这是正常的,Python也不例外。某些扩展库升级过程中解决原来问题的同时又引入了新的错误,导致某些功能在旧版本中工作正常但在新版本中却无法使用。

3K10

最全总结 | 聊聊 Python 数据处理全家桶(Sqlite篇)

前言 上篇文章 聊到 Python 处理 Mysql 数据库最常见的两种方式,本篇文章继续说另外一种比较常用的数据库:Sqlite Sqlite 是一种 嵌入式数据库,数据库就是一个文件,体积很小,底层由...C 语言编写,经常被集成到移动应用程序中 事实Python 内置了 sqlite3 模块,不需要安装任何依赖,就可以直接操作 Sqlite 数据库 2....准备 和 Python 操作 Mysql 类似,操作 Sqlite 主要包含下面 2 种方式: sqlite3 + 原生 SQL SQLAlchemy + ORM 3. sqlite3 + 原生 SQL...由于 Python 内置了 sqlite3 模块,这里直接导入就可以使用了 # 导入内置模块sqlite3 import sqlite3 首先,我们使用 sqlite3 的 connnect() 方法创建一个数据库连接对象...self.conn.commit() except Exception as e: self.conn.rollback() print('插入一条记录失败

1.2K30

记录一个Mac OS X 中本地安装Ghost 的报错问题

新买的Macbook Air 升级了最新版的OS X 10.10 Yosemite,昨天本地安装Ghost 的时候出现了问题,在这里做一个记录。...安装node 和 npm 整个过程Jeff 是通过http://docs.ghostchina.com/zh/installation/mac/ 的文档进行操作的,安装 node 和 npm 的话没问题...,虽然安装教程来果然出现了$PATH 环境变量无效的问题,但是按照文档操作也很快解决了。.../binding\Release\node-v11-darwin-x64\node_sqlite3.node'" 解决方案 通过搜索了十几个页面找到了如下原因及解决方案: 原因是:安装sqlite3 数据库失败...,失败的可能原因是安装源Amazon S3被墙(虽然我是全局代理模式下安装的); 解决方案:通过 http://node-sqlite3.s3.amazonaws.com/Release/node_sqlite3

1.6K90

python中查看.db文件中表格的名字及表格中的字段操作

实例代码如下: # coding:utf-8 import sqlite3 conn = sqlite3.connect("C:\Users\Administrator\Desktop\密码账号.db"...# coding:utf-8 import sqlite3 conn = sqlite3.connect("C:\Users\Administrator\Desktop\密码账号.db") cursor...补充知识:pythonsqlite3模块查询数据一条或多条 我就废话不多说了,大家还是直接看代码吧~ #导入模块 import sqlite3 #创建链接 con = sqlite3.connect(...person in person_all: print(person) print("查询数据成功") except Exception as e: print(e) print("查询数据失败...") finally: cur.close() con.close() 以上这篇python中查看.db文件中表格的名字及表格中的字段操作就是小编分享给大家的全部内容了,希望能给大家一个参考。

2.2K30

原来Python自带了数据库,用起来真方便!

数据一般存放在本地文件或者数据库里,之前介绍过如何使用python读取本地文件,也对# PyMySQL、cx_Oracle等数据库连接库做过简单的使用分享。...这次推荐一个python自带的轻量级数据库模块-sqlite3,先要弄清楚什么是SQLite: ❝SQLite是一种用C写的小巧的嵌入式数据库,它的数据库就是一个文件。...❞ sqlite3模块不同于PyMySQL模块,PyMySQL是一个python与mysql的沟通管道,需要你本地安装配置好mysql才能使用,而SQLite是python自带的数据库,不需要任何配置...# 创建与数据库的连接 conn = sqlite3.connect('test.db') 还可以在内存中创建数据库,只要输入特殊参数值:memory:即可,该数据库只存在于内存中,不会生成本地数据库文件..., data) # 连接完数据库并不会自动提交,所以需要手动 commit 你的改动conn.commit() 5.

2.2K40
领券